Senior Software Engineer

NikeBeaverton, OR
Remote

About The Position

Serve as an integral member of a multi-functional engineering teams that delivers solutions unlocking machine learning for Nike; analyze and profile data to uncover insights in support of scalable solutions, clean, prepare and verify the integrity of data for analysis and model creation; track model accuracy, performance, relevance, and reliability; apply a variety of machine learning and collaborative filtering methods to data sets; aid in building APIs and software libraries that support adoption of models in production; leverage prior experience, knowledge of industry trends, and personal creativity to develop new and innovative solutions which delight our customers in their mission to serve Athletes; stay ahead of with industry trends and recommend relevant technologies & products in the areas of Analytics, Machine Learning, Artificial Intelligence, and Data Science tools and other emerging technologies; embrace and embody Nike’s core values (Maxims) in work and interactions with peers and stakeholders; communicate effectively, building trust and strong relationships across the company.

Requirements

  • Master’s degree in Software Engineering, Computer Engineering, and Computer Science
  • 2 years of experience in the job offered or in a engineering- related occupation
  • Distributed Systems
  • CI/CD Pipelines
  • Machine Learning Pipelines
  • Cloud Platforms (Azure, AWS, GCP)
  • API Development
  • Model development and Training
  • Databricks
  • Apache Spark
  • Deep Learning Frameworks (TensorFlow, PyTorch)
  • Lakehouse architecture
  • Large-Scale Data Preprocessing
  • Programming (Python, SQL, C++)
  • LLM Models (Generative AI, RAG)
  • Data Governance

Responsibilities

  • Analyze and profile data to uncover insights in support of scalable solutions
  • Clean, prepare and verify the integrity of data for analysis and model creation
  • Track model accuracy, performance, relevance, and reliability
  • Apply a variety of machine learning and collaborative filtering methods to data sets
  • Build APIs and software libraries that support adoption of models in production
  • Develop new and innovative solutions which delight our customers in their mission to serve Athletes
  • Stay ahead of industry trends and recommend relevant technologies & products in the areas of Analytics, Machine Learning, Artificial Intelligence, and Data Science tools and other emerging technologies
  • Embrace and embody Nike’s core values (Maxims) in work and interactions with peers and stakeholders
  • Communicate effectively, building trust and strong relationships across the company
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service